How do you become a paramedic?

A paramedic is a step above an EMT and is at the advanced level. In addition to the abilities learned as EMTs, paramedics are trained to provide advanced life support. In addition to exactly what an EMT is trained to do, which includes performing CPR, treating injuries, etc., a paramedic can give medications, start IVs, offer injections, offer advanced respiratory tract management, and more. Upon graduation from a paramedics program, a person can make more cash than an EMT and receive much better job chances in the field.

Understanding The Requirements

This is the initial step in your journey to becoming a certified paramedic. The requirements can differ from state to state, but eligibility specifications are normally the very same. They consist of:

  1. Need to be at least 18 years old.
  2. Should be a high school graduate or hold a GED
  3. Must have a legitimate chauffeur’s license
  4. Must be a licensed EMT

At times, you might have to make it through some places which are hard to reach and this is why you may find that the dexterity of your hands to handle, finger or feel is checked. If you satisfy all these requirements, you are eligible for first responder training or emergency medical responder training.

The steps to become a paramedic include:

  1. EMT basic is mandatory for anybody who wishes to become a paramedic. EMT basic can be finished in less than one year at technical organizations or neighborhood colleges. As soon as you are certified as an EMT basic, you can proceed to paramedic school.
  2. EMT courses will include instruction in physiology, anatomy, and advanced medical abilities. After completing the course, you will have to complete internship for a specific number of hours doing operate in the emergency, ambulance or fire department.
  3. From here, particular requirements from one state to another have the tendency to differ considerably. For example, in Texas, you may be asked to take the Texas College Assessment examination or an approved alternative like COMPASS. In some states, you’ll have to have an Associates Degree to become licensed to work as a paramedic. So, learn more about the particular requirements of your state and the school that you are considering to enlist.
  4. A paramedic program consists of class training which includes anatomy and physiology, advanced life support, advanced pediatric life support and basic trauma life support. It also consists of clinical training at locations such as health centers, fire departments, etc. Pre-requisites for the training exists which often include the six months of EMT training, plus biology, English, and math at the college level.
  5. When you complete your paramedic course or program, you will more than likely wish to become Nationally Qualified from the National Registry of Emergency Medical Technicians (NREMT). This will require you to pass the NREMT examinations. They generally consist of a skills test in addition to a computer system adaptive examination. Passing this test is a presentation that you have met the across the country certification standard. Ideally, it gives you broader flexibility in case you transfer to a various state. All you will have to do is send an application for reciprocity, provided the states accepts National Registry as the requirement for licensure and admittance.
